Latest Patents
One of his latest inventions is a device for shear-thinning of solids containing material. This device is designed to be used in conjunction with thickening and clarifying apparatuses. It features two conduits: one for feeding material to be shear-thinned and another for discharging the shear-thinned material. These conduits are positioned concentrically at the ends connected to the thickening apparatus. Another significant patent is a pre-separation feed well for use with hydrous slurry feed in a hindered-bed separator. This invention includes an elongate body with a vertically adjustable conical plate to control the downward flow of heavy material. The design allows for the introduction of feed in a tangential manner, enhancing the efficiency of the separation process.
